Educational conferences for teachers are organized events designed to provide professional development opportunities, networking platforms, and sharing of innovative teaching practices. They often feature keynote speakers, workshops, panel discussions, and exhibit halls showcasing educational resources and technology aimed at enhancing teacher effectiveness and student outcomes.

Cons
- Can be costly in terms of registration and travel expenses
- May require time away from regular teaching duties
- Quality and relevance can vary between conferences
- Crowded sessions may limit personalized learning experiences
